Handover: Exportron retry queue

Hi Mira — handing over the failed-export retries. Exports that hit a timeout land in the retry queue and get three attempts with backoff; after that they're parked and need a manual requeue from the admin panel. Watch for customers reporting duplicates — that usually means a double requeue. The current retry settings are as follows.

settings of bajog-fawig:
oliael:
  log_level: warn
  metrics_host: metrics.oliael.zemvarsys.internal
  pin: 0267
  pool_size: 32

## Break-Glass Access: Tokenweave Session Refresh Bug

Since the v4.2 regression, Tokenweave occasionally invalidates admin session tokens mid-refresh, locking maintainers out of the Larkspur control plane. If normal re-authentication fails twice, do not keep retrying — the lockout counter is shared across replicas. Instead, use the break-glass flow documented here, which bypasses the refresh cycle entirely. The flow requires the recovery passphrase below.

recovery phrase for bafof-kajof: quenmir-ralmir-praeth

## Further reading

The MendWell reminder job is small but has history — it's been rewritten twice after double-send incidents. Before changing the send window logic, skim the postmortems and the quiet-hours spec; both explain why the dedupe key includes clinic timezone. Retry semantics are deliberately conservative. For architecture notes, past incidents, and the scheduling spec, see the internal page linked below.

wiki page, fahaf-yagag: https://confluence.qorvellabs.internal/pages/display/pages/display